No War with Iran! CPI Organizes Protests in 8 Cities Across America

On February 28th, as the US was attacking Iran, the Center for Political Innovation (CPI) organized protests in New York City, Chicago, Minneapolis, Los Angeles, and Portland. Smaller gatherings were also organized in Joshua Tree, California; St. Louis, Missouri; and Davenport, Iowa.

Participants emphasized the need for a government of action that fights for working families, and exposed the hijacking of the US government by the Zionist lobby and the “Epstein Class.” In every city, protests received an amazingly warm reception, with lots of thumbs up and signs of support, hundreds of flyers distributed, and many people taking photos and wanting more information about CPI and the anti-war movement.
